Abstract

The invention discloses a polymerization breeding method for rice. The polymerization breeding method for the rice comprises the following steps: selecting and determining a backbone variety of rice, taking four mutant varieties of the backbone variety of the rice as breeding materials, wherein different mutant varieties at least have one different excellent agronomic trait; grouping the four mutant varieties into two groups, mutually hybridizing the two mutant varieties in the first pair to obtain first double-cross F1<++> plants, and mutually hybridizing the two mutant varieties in the second pair to obtain second double-cross F1<++> plants; mutually hybridizing the first double-cross F1<++> plants and the second double-cross F1<++> plants to obtain four-way-cross F1<++++> plants; carrying out selfing on the four-way-cross F1<++++> plants, selecting four mutant varieties in four-way-cross F2<++++> plants and polymerizing to obtain a single polymerization plant with excellent agronomic trait; and systemically breeding the posterities of the single polymerization plant. The high-speed polymerization breeding method for the rice is simple, convenient and efficient, and is short in breeding period.

Background technology
For improving the general performance power of paddy disease-resistant, pest-resistant, quality and yield, carrying out multiple characters pyramiding breeding is important technological means.Concrete breeding method is diverse for the genetic background with different merit kind and the good kind of a Comprehensive Traits, respectively hybridization and back cross breeding.
Publication number is the selection that the Chinese patent literature of CN102754591A discloses a kind of multi-resistance rice germplasm, comprises the following steps: carry the parent P1 of Bacterial blight resistance gene Xa21 and Xa23 simultaneously and carry blast resistant gene Pi-K simultaneously hwith the parent P2 phase mutual cross of Pi-1, obtain hybridization F1; Plantation F1, maturing stage sowing obtains F2 seed; Plantation F2, by going out the individual plant of the disease-resistant marker genetype of heterozygosis with the closely linked molecular marker screening of disease-resistant gene; The individual plant of plantation screening, results selfing F3 seed; Plantation selfing F3, selected the individual plant carrying the disease-resistant marker genetype that isozygotys by Molecular Marker Assisted Selection Technology, heading stage and recurrent parent P3 are hybridized; The hybridization F1 that plantation obtains, heading stage and recurrent parent P3 backcross, and obtain BC1F1 seed; Plantation BC1F1 seed, therefrom selects that strain Leaf pattern is close with recurrent parent P3 and individual plant that the is disease-resistant marker genetype of heterozygosis continues and recurrent parent P3 continuous backcross 3 generation, acquisition BC3F2 seed; Plantation BC3F2 seed, therefrom selects strain Leaf pattern and the individual plant selfing of heterozygosis disease-resistant marker genetype close with recurrent parent P3, acquisition BC3F3 strain, is tested and appraised, screens and obtain multi-resistant rice.
The parent P1 simultaneously carrying Bacterial blight resistance gene Xa21 and Xa23 and the parent P2 simultaneously carrying blast resistant gene Pi-Kh and Pi-1 are parent's raw material by above-mentioned patent, by convergent cross and Molecular Marker Assisted Selection Technology, Pi1, PiKh, Xa21 and the Xa23 be dispersed in different anti-source is imported in same rice germplasm, but breeding cycle is long, need the hybridization in many generations, backcross process.
Breeding cycle length is ubiquitous problem in current multiple characters paddy rice pyramiding breeding, due to the otherness of breeding material genetic background, proterties stable needs the hybridization grown to backcross the time very much, in addition, due to the greatest differences of breeding material genetic background, characters of progenies separate complex, the selection of breeding is difficult to control, and what cause breeding final goal is difficult to expection.When the merit be polymerized is more, the problems referred to above are also more outstanding, and often cause the failure of breeding.
With paddy rice key variety for object, the mutant of mutagenic and breeding series of different, has established good basis to parsing Main Agronomic Characters Forming Mechanism and breeding utilization.But the comprehensive utilization with different merit mutant is polymerized with proterties and not yet effectively carries out.
Summary of the invention
The present invention proposes a kind of paddy rice rapid polymerization breeding technique, and simple and effective, breeding cycle are short.
A kind of paddy rice pyramiding breeding method, comprising:
(1) select to determine paddy rice key variety, select four mutant lines deriving from this paddy rice key variety as breeding material, there is between different mutant lines the excellent economical character that at least one is different;
(2) it is two right to be divided into by described four mutant lines, and two mutant lines phases mutual cross of the first centering, obtains the first double cross F 1 ++for plant, two mutant lines phases mutual cross of the second centering, obtains the second double cross F 1 ++for plant;
(3) first double cross F 1 ++for plant and the second double cross F 1 ++for the mutual cross of plant phase, obtain four and hand over F 1 ++++for plant;
(4) four hand over F 1 ++++for plant selfing, obtain four and hand over F 2 ++++for plant, hand over F four 2 ++++the polymerization individual plant of selective polymerization four excellent economical characters of mutant lines in plant;
(5) systematic breeding is carried out to the offspring of described polymerization individual plant, obtain the rice varieties of multiple characters polymerization.
Described excellent economical character be tall and big strong stalk, disease-resistant, pest-resistant, tiller more, long grain, high-resistance starch or ripe late.
In step (5), the algebraically of described systematic breeding was 2 ~ 4 generations.By systematic breeding, carry out excellent in select excellent, can obtain the rice varieties of the multiple merit of stable polymerization (four kinds of mutant), generally, the algebraically of systematic breeding can shorten to for 2 generations.
As wherein a kind of selectable embodiment, described paddy rice key variety is " raising rice No. 6 ", and four described mutant lines are " the close rice in Zhejiang No. 1 ", " Zhejiang rice No. 1 ", " the anti-rice in Zhejiang No. 1 " and " Zhejiang many fringes rice ".Point pair time, preferably, described " the close rice in Zhejiang No. 1 " and " Zhejiang rice No. 1 " is a pair, and described " the anti-rice in Zhejiang No. 1 " and " Zhejiang many fringes rice " is a pair.
Alternatively, described paddy rice key variety is " Zhejiang extensive 7954 ", and four described mutant lines are " Zhejiang spoke 111 ", " the extensive 7954-LG2 in Zhejiang ", " the extensive 7954-BG3 in Zhejiang " and " LR7954 ".Point pair time, preferably, described " Zhejiang spoke 111 " and " the extensive 7954-LG2 in Zhejiang " is a pair, and described " the extensive 7954-BG3 in Zhejiang " and " LR7954 " is a pair.
Compared with prior art, beneficial effect of the present invention is:
(1) the present invention selects the mutant deriving from same paddy rice key variety as breeding material, due in rice breeding, the seed selection of rice mutant is carried out for specific economical character target, and other economical character and paddy rice key variety are similar to, so all mutant are except specific economical character is (as disease-resistant, pest-resistant, quality etc.) outward, remaining economical character is more consistent, that is the genetic background difference between all companion planting rice varieties is little, there is the uniformity of height, other proterties homogeneous of such breeding progeny is very easy to fast and stable and is convenient to select, compared with the huge kind pyramiding breeding of different genetic background difference, breeding selection facilitates feasible, breeding objective it is expected to.
(2) compared with the existing multiple characters pyramiding breeding that other is originated, breeding cycle of the present invention shorter (about general five generations), breeding process is more simple efficient.
